libidav/davqlexec.c

changeset 331
9ca1e4706acc
parent 290
1e3e374d9386
child 348
b79fb94f9e0a
equal deleted inserted replaced
330:54819e984a19 331:9ca1e4706acc
1054 DAVQL_PUSH(obj); 1054 DAVQL_PUSH(obj);
1055 break; 1055 break;
1056 } 1056 }
1057 case DAVQL_CMD_PROP_IDENTIFIER: { 1057 case DAVQL_CMD_PROP_IDENTIFIER: {
1058 //printf("property %s:%s\n", cmd.data.property.ns, cmd.data.property.name); 1058 //printf("property %s:%s\n", cmd.data.property.ns, cmd.data.property.name);
1059 char *value = dav_get_property_ns(res, cmd.data.property.ns, cmd.data.property.name); 1059 char *value = dav_get_string_property_ns(res, cmd.data.property.ns, cmd.data.property.name);
1060 obj.type = 1; 1060 obj.type = 1;
1061 obj.length = value ? strlen(value) : 0; 1061 obj.length = value ? strlen(value) : 0;
1062 obj.data.string = value; 1062 obj.data.string = value;
1063 DAVQL_PUSH(obj); 1063 DAVQL_PUSH(obj);
1064 break; 1064 break;

mercurial